thinkPHP控制器变量在模板中的显示方法示例
本文实例讲述了thinkPHP控制器变量在模板中的显示方法。分享给大家供大家参考,具体如下:
控制器中变量
publicfunctionregister(){ $type=I("param.type");//1.学生注册2.教师注册3.其他注册 $this->assign("type",$type); //q全部部门 $depart1=M("Depart")->where("status=1andfid=0")->order("idasc")->select(); $this->assign("depart1",$depart1); $this->display(); }
模板中引用位置一:php代码中,直接用$i;
echo$i; 模板中引用位置二:模板中直接应用{$i}或者class="{$unlogined}"
注意:1.非相关人员,严禁注册。{$i}
$logined=is_array($_SESSION['userInfo'])?"":"hide-div"; $unlogined=$logined=="hide-div"?"":"hide-div"; 模板中引用位置三:模板标签中用,如condition中用,不加{}。
一级部门: * -----请选择一级部门----- {$vo.name}